Ice Packs vs PCM Coolants: What's Best for Temperature-Sensitive Shipments?
Choosing between gel ice packs and PCM coolants can make or break a temperature-sensitive shipment. Gel packs are affordable and reliable for shorter, lower-risk journeys, but they offer limited precision. PCM coolants provide tighter, longer-lasting temperature control for high-value pharma, biotech and perishable goods, helping prevent excursions, cold shock and product loss.
